Asphalt Lot Paving Questions
What types of projects are suitable for asphalt lot paving? Asphalt paving is ideal for driveways, parking lots, and access roads on residential and commercial properties.
How long does an asphalt parking lot typically last? The lifespan of an asphalt lot depends on usage and maintenance, but it generally ranges from 15 to 20 years.
What preparation is needed before asphalt paving begins? The area should be properly graded and free of debris to ensure a stable base for paving.
Can asphalt be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, asphalt can often be laid over existing pavement if the surface is in suitable condition.
